Seven News Sydney anchor Mark Ferguson taking on maternity role on Jonesy & Amanda show

Mark FergusonSeven News Sydney anchor Mark Ferguson is set for a four-week stint covering the news bulletins on the WSFM breakfast show with Jonesy and Amanda from next week.

Ferguson, will still present the 6pm bulletins after being promoted to host them ahead of Chris Bath earlier this year, but will also cover current newsreader Sarah Forster who is going on maternity leave.

The move is an opportunity to promote Ferguson to a wider audience for Seven, with the news in Sydney struggling in the ratings against Nine News this year. The breakfast show with Brendan Jones and Amanda Keller was second in the Sydney FM ratings behind Kyle and Jackie O’s Kiis 1065 breakfast show according to the last survey.

 In a release this morning Keller said: “Mark is an exceptional journalist, foreign correspondent and news reader with more than 30 years’ experience – but will that prepare him for sharing our box of Weet-Bix and seeing my face at 5.30am every morning?”

“I watch Mark on the 6pm news, he is always very well presented and professional so I look forward to roughing him up a bit,” Jones said.

Mark added: “What really “gets my goolies”, as Jonesy & Amanda would say, is getting up before the sun, but this will be well worth it.

“I can’t wait to join Mr and Mrs Radio for lots of Weet-Bix and a bit of news. Oh, and management have told me I can play as many Bob Dylan and INXS tunes as I like – just don’t tell Jonesy and Amanda.”

Forster has read the news on the show for the last three years.
